Gli Animali Miniature Cabinet by Hans Von Klier, Italy, 1969

About the Item

This cabinet is from a series of playful and colorful miniatures Hans von Klier designed in 1969 for the storage of jewelry, coins and candy. Hans von Klier graduated from the Ulm School of Design in 1959 before moving to Milan, Italy. In Italy von Klier worked in the studio of Ettore Sottsass creating furniture and office equipment for Olivetti, the Praxis 48 Typewriter among their collaborative designs. In 1968 von Klier became the director of Corporate Identity of Olivetti & C., a position he held until 1989. This miniature cabinet features one door and seven drawers.
